Interior Designers

SOC 27-1025 · 2024-2034

Plan, design, and furnish the internal space of rooms or buildings. Design interior environments or create physical layouts that are practical, aesthetic, and conducive to the intended purposes. May specialize in a particular field, style, or phase of interior design.

What the pay actually ranges across

The lowest-paid tenth earn under
$52,366
A quarter earn under
$65,144
Half earn under
$82,476
Three quarters earn under
$105,822
The highest-paid tenth earn over
$135,459

A median is one point. These are the federal Bureau of Labor Statistics' 2026 figures for California, and they say how far apart the people doing this job actually are. Read them as the spread across everyone already in the work — not as a starting wage and not as a promise about where anyone lands.
